Anti-TIM antibodies are used in antigen-specific immunodetection in biological samples. The target TIM is a known alias name of the protein triosephosphate isomerase 1, encoded by the TPI1 gene in humans. This 249-amino acid residue protein is a member of the Triosephosphate isomerase protein family. It is localized to the cytoplasm of the cell. Western Blot is a widely used application for the TIM antibodies listed below. In addition, ELISA is also a common application.
